MsSql多数据库兼容性与互操作性深度解析
|
在移动应用开发过程中,数据库的兼容性与互操作性是不可忽视的关键因素。对于使用 Microsoft SQL Server 的开发者来说,理解其与其他数据库系统的兼容性能够有效提升应用的可移植性和扩展性。 MsSql 作为一款企业级关系型数据库系统,支持多种数据访问接口和协议,例如 ODBC、JDBC 和 ADO.NET。这些接口使得 MsSql 能够与 MySQL、PostgreSQL 甚至 Oracle 等其他数据库进行数据交互,为多数据库架构提供了技术基础。 在实际开发中,跨数据库的数据迁移和同步往往需要借助 ETL 工具或自定义脚本。虽然 MsSql 提供了丰富的内置功能,但在处理非标准 SQL 语法或特定数据库特性时,仍需注意兼容性问题,避免因语义差异导致数据错误。 随着云原生应用的兴起,许多开发者开始采用混合数据库策略。在这种情况下,MsSql 通过 Azure 数据库服务实现了与云平台的深度集成,同时也支持与本地数据库的无缝连接,提升了系统的灵活性。 为了确保互操作性,开发者应优先使用标准 SQL 语法,并在必要时利用 ORM 框架如 Entity Framework 来抽象底层数据库差异。这不仅简化了代码维护,也降低了因数据库更换带来的风险。
AI生成的电路图,仅供参考 站长个人见解,掌握 MsSql 在多数据库环境中的兼容性与互操作性,是移动应用开发者提升系统健壮性和适应性的关键一步。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

